The MicroNutrient Test measures your body’s ability to absorb 32 vitamins, minerals, antioxidants and other essential nutrients within your white blood cells. This non-fasting blood test tells you if you have a vitamin deficiency and gives you a plan for how to correct it.
More importantly, the results information can help you reduce the risk of illness and disease related to such deficiencies.

Normal Range:
Adequate levels vary for each nutrient tested. Adequate levels are indicated in the test results according to reference range listed.
High Results Indicate:
There is no high results indicate for this test.
Low Results Indicate:
Values that represent a deficiency are clearly marked for each nutrient. Patient may require nutrient repletion or dietary changes to correct deficiencies.
Your primary care physician can review these results with you to recommend a supplement plan. All report results are given in an easy-to-read format and repletion recommendations are included.
